Modular cable hang-offs are designed to provide secure termination, stability, and protection for cables in offshore and subsea environments. Their design features are tailored to meet the specific challenges of these demanding applications.  

Features

 • High mechanical strength

Purpose: Withstand significant axial and radial forces caused by cable tension, environmental loads, and thermal expansion.  

Design: Reinforced steel or composite sleeves are used to ensure high load-bearing capacity.  

Dutch cable protection 

Purpose: Minimize damage to cables during installation and operation.  

Design: Smooth internal surfaces and flexible seals are integrated to prevent abrasion or mechanical damage.  

Corrosion resistance

Purpose: Ensure long-term durability in marine environments exposed to saltwater, high humidity, and temperature fluctuations.  

Design: Made from corrosion-resistant materials like stainless steel or coated with marine-grade paints.  

Customizable components

Purpose: Adapt to different cable diameters, configurations, and project-specific requirements.  

Design: Modular structures and adjustable grouting systems allow for flexibility in design and installation.  

Integrated sealing systems

Purpose: Prevent water ingress and maintain structural integrity in subsea conditions.  

Design: Incorporate elastomeric seals or polyurethane coatings to create a watertight barrier.  

Fatigue and vibration resistance

Purpose: Mitigate the effects of dynamic loading caused by waves, currents, or cable movement.  

Design: Use of flexible components and damping systems to absorb vibrations and reduce stress.

Application scope of modular cable hang-off

Modular cable hang-offs are widely used in offshore and subsea industries where cables need to be securely terminated and stabilized.  

Offshore wind farms

Usage: For securing power export cables and inter-array cables that connect offshore wind turbines to substations or the mainland.  

Advantages: Provide stable, long-term solutions for high-tension cables in dynamic marine environments. 

 • Oil and gas platforms

Usage: Terminate and protect umbilicals, risers, and power cables supplying oil and gas platforms.  

Advantages: Capable of withstanding extreme loads and corrosive conditions.  

Subsea pipelines

Usage: Secure cables used in subsea pipeline monitoring and control systems.  

Advantages: Offer a permanent, robust connection that resists underwater currents and pressure changes.  

Floating production systems

Usage: Terminate dynamic cables used in floating production storage and offloading (FPSO) systems or tension leg platforms (TLPs).  

Advantages: Designed to handle dynamic motions and maintain the integrity of cables.  

Coastal and harbor projects

Usage: Stabilize underwater power cables and communication lines in coastal or harbor installations.  

Advantages: Effective in shallow water environments where external forces are less intense but stability is still essential.  

Telecommunications

Usage: Secure subsea fiber optic cables in telecom networks.  

Advantages: Provides a reliable solution for protecting and anchoring sensitive communication cables.
